Structuresnarrative is a term used to describe the way in which a story is organized and presented to the audience. It refers to the underlying framework or architecture that supports the narrative, including the plot structure, character development, and thematic elements. The term is often used in the fields of literature, film, and other forms of storytelling to analyze and discuss the construction of narratives.
